How Water Dispenser Works?
In the modern dispenser water coolers, air filtration system is fitted inside the dispenser so to stop bacteria from entering into the machine. This system also eliminates the chances of contaminating water, preventing toxins from penetrating within the machine, hence allowing preserving of sanitized water. The entire air filtration process ensures the safety of health when drinking pure water.
Structure of Water Dispenser Bottle
The bottles which are usually used by dispenser companies comprise sealed or air tight bottle caps. This structure promotes assurance of pure and clean water which cannot be adulterated.
Water tanks which are kept inside the dispenser are manufactured with high food grade stainless steel material. So, it cannot be rusty. Such stainless steel material is hardly susceptible to bacteria. Moreover, the taps available on the front side of the dispenser are made of plastic. This helps in preventing the growth of bacteria and grime.
With such a combination, water dispenser fights bacterial growth efficiently while retaining optimum taste and quality of drinking water.
How Often You Need the Service of Water Dispenser?
If you have placed your water dispenser in a clean environment, then probably, you don’t need its service during its use. It can only get contaminated if it’s standing without a bottle or in a dirty environment. Just like the other home appliances, it should be cleaned on a daily basis by following its user manual.
